description ABSTRACTGrowth in different culture media and temperature as well as its antagonic roleagainst Fusarium oxysporumSchlencht f. sp. dianthi(Prill and amp; Del) Snyder and amp; Hansen, werestudied on an isolated of the fungi Theobroma grandiflorum(Spreng) K. Schum. Lowgrowth and the presence of abundat moniloid cells were detected when the fungi wascultured in PDA in microculture, with natural light and at 20ºC. Higher temperatures(27ºC and 30ºC) increased growh rate. When cultured at 20ºC, in darkness, similarresults as those recorded at 30ºC in natural light were found. After a month sclerotiagrotwh was present. Culture in AMS in Petri dishes, with natural light at 20ºC showedgrowth in patches which suggests phenotype variability. Poor growth was recordedwhen cultured in AAg. Our results showed that rapid and vigorous growth isobtanined when the fungi is cultured in PDA at 30ºC in darkness producing conidiaand sclerotia. T. grandiflorumalso has an antagonic role against F.oxysporumsp. dianthi,growing faster and inihibitingits growth.
